Flowery Branch's location near Lake Lanier creates unique turf installation considerations that most contractors underestimate. That clay-heavy soil composition in Hall County holds moisture differently than other regions—which is great for drainage planning but means we size subsurface systems accordingly. Properties in Sterling on the Lake and surrounding newer developments often deal with compacted soil from construction, so we've developed specific prep protocols for the area. Sun exposure varies significantly depending on whether your commercial space sits near the water or further inland; lakeside properties experience more humidity and UV intensity, while tree-lined developments may have partial shade challenges. Many commercial properties here also fall under HOA landscape guidelines—we work within those restrictions and can actually help you meet aesthetic requirements more reliably than seasonal plantings. The region's newer construction means many lots have modern drainage infrastructure, which we leverage during installation. Parking lots, service areas, and high-traffic zones around Flowery Branch facilities benefit enormously from turf because the clay substrate doesn't compact the same way natural grass does. Winter dormancy is minimal here, so your turf maintains color and usability through most of the year.

Hall County's clay requires a different prep approach than sandier soils. We break up compacted clay, install proper base layers for drainage, and account for the soil's tendency to hold moisture. This isn't a one-size-fits-all process—we assess your specific lot. It actually makes for more stable installations once done correctly because clay provides excellent sub-base compaction.
